Exploring Different Types of Spine Surgery Available in France for Quebec Patients
Patients considering surgical intervention for spinal pathologies can encounter a broad range of options in France, distinguished chiefly by their invasiveness, purpose, and biomechanical implications. These procedures generally fall into three categories: simple surgeries, fusion surgeries, and motion-preserving surgeries. Understanding these categories helps clarify treatment goals and anticipated outcomes.
Simple Spine Surgeries: Targeted Relieving Techniques
Simple surgical procedures typically involve minimally invasive decompression techniques, designed to relieve nerve root or spinal cord compression caused by herniated discs, spinal stenosis, or other localized conditions. Using small incisions and guided by imaging technology, these surgeries aim to reduce tissue trauma and preserve as much natural spinal structure as possible. Patients benefit from shortened hospital stays and faster recovery periods. For example, microdiscectomy is a commonly performed simple surgery that removes herniated disc material pressing on nerves, often resulting in immediate symptom relief.
Fusion Surgeries: Stabilizing the Spine
When spinal instability or deformity is significant, fusion surgeries are recommended. These procedures involve permanently joining two or more vertebrae using implants such as screws, rods, or cages to strengthen the spine and alleviate pain. While fusion can effectively address severe degenerative changes or complex deformities, it alters spinal biomechanics by restricting segmental motion, which may have long-term implications on adjacent spinal levels. Advances in minimally invasive fusion techniques in France allow for smaller incisions, reduced blood loss, and decreased hospital stays, contrasting with more invasive traditional fusion surgeries.
Motion-Preserving Surgeries: Maintaining Natural Spinal Movement
Emerging techniques focus on preserving or restoring the spine’s natural motion, seeking to combine pain relief with mobility maintenance. Procedures using dynamic implants or artificial disc replacements are examples of this category. These surgeries are particularly promising for patients who wish to avoid the rigidity that accompanies spinal fusion. French surgical centers specialized in such advanced motion-preserving techniques provide insights into balancing mechanical integrity and functional outcomes, frequently supported by preoperative assessments and postoperative care plans tailored to individual patient needs.

Biochemical and Biomechanical Advantages of Minimally Invasive Procedures in Spinal Surgery
Minimally invasive surgery (MIS) revolutionizes spinal treatment by preserving the integrity of soft tissues and maintaining natural spinal biomechanics. Such approaches enhance functional outcomes and patient satisfaction by reducing common complications associated with open surgeries.
Preservation of Spinal Structure and Motion
Unlike traditional open surgeries that require extensive muscle dissection, MIS techniques use small incisions and specialized tools to access the spine, preserving paraspinal muscles and ligaments. This preservation is crucial for maintaining spinal stability and mobility post-surgery. Dynamic implants and artificial discs further support motion preservation, mitigating risks of adjacent segment degeneration that are common after fusion.
Reduced Tissue Trauma and Accelerated Healing
The use of laser technologies and neurovertébral decompression in minimally invasive procedures results in less bleeding, lower infection rates, and decreased postoperative pain. These factors contribute to significantly shortened hospital stay durations and faster functional recovery—a major benefit for patients eager to return to normal activities.
